Kenosha Kid said:
Sometimes called an "STP Studebaker" sign...it was also used as part of an oil rack display:

http://www.worthpoint.com/worthopedia/stp-vintage-oil-rack-stand-sign-embossed-studebaker

They also used a similar design for the "German Developed" sign in 1962:

http://www.worthpoint.com/worthopedia/1962-stp-studebaker-hanging-motor-oil-sign

Another one like yours is listed in a picture below it; however, the link won't work (to post here) and shows as "sold".
